Capitalism Reconnected Toward a Sustainable, Inclusive and Innovative Market Economy in Europe

Part I Europe’s Present Condition: A DiagnosisCHAPTER 1 Introduction: From the Challenge of 2015 to the Shock of 2022CHAPTER 2 Europe’s 250-Year Project…CHAPTER 3 Triumphant Capitalism: Bold Assumptions of an Overconfident Age CHAPTER 4 Europe’s Confusion and ReorientationPart II Europe’s Mission: Developing Responsible CapitalismCHAPTER 5 The First Pillar of Renewal: Europe’s Ideals CHAPTER 6 The Second Pillar of Renewal: Inspiration from Revaluing Europe’s StoryCHAPTER 7 The Third Pillar of Renewal: Ideas about Economics CHAPTER 8 The Fourth Pillar of Renewal: Indicators and the New Art of MeasurementCHAPTER 9 The Fifth Pillar of Renewal: Institutions and the Multiactor ApproachCHAPTER 10The Flying Wheel of Responsible Innovation (A): the ‘Makers’ of a New Economy (Business, Finance, Consumers)CHAPTER 11 The Flying Wheel of Responsible Innovation (B): the ‘Embedders’ of a New Economy (Government, Nature, Community, Civil Society) CHAPTER 12 The Flying Wheel of Responsible Innovation (C): the ‘Critical Innovators’ of a New Economy (Media, Research and Education, Imaginative Reflection)Part III Europe’s New Position: Global Player for the Common GoodCHAPTER 13 A New World Order is EmergingCHAPTER 14 Europe’s Contribution in Tomorrow’s WorldCHAPTER 15 In Conclusion: Challenges and Recommendations for a Rejuvenated EuropeEPILOGUE: Towards an Economics of HopeCapitalism has gone astray. Today we face ecological exhaustion, persistent inequality, financialization, stress on communities, short-termism, and new power concentrations. An avalanche of new economic thinking and a reorientation of European values show the way toward a different economy. A new perspective is necessary if we want to implement the Sustainable Development Goals and if we consider our planet as ‘Our Common Home,’ for present and future generations. This book argues that European economies should be the initiators of a global transition toward a sustainable and inclusive world economy. Together, amid severe geopolitical and geoeconomic challenges, they need to develop their own perspective on what a good economy really is, in distinction to Chinese state capitalism and American big business capitalism. Crucially, this requires the rediscovery of key European values, a coherent view on responsible capitalism, and a new self-awareness as a global player for the Common Good in today’s and tomorrow’s world.
